Now to your question. The reason God could not completely reveal himself to Moses was because Moses would have died instantly. Just like if you get too close to the sun, or if you are in the vicinity of a nuclear explosion. The Hebrew expressions that we have translated as face and back of God are metaphors for the Glory of God. You can look at a star in the sky, But not the sun. Moses wanted to see more of God than he already had. God accommodated him but had to shield Moses from the full expression of his presence. That's why He hid him in the rocks.
